Jan Adhikar Sangram Parishad stages peaceful protest at Churaibari border against Assam eviction drive

Date:

By TC News Desk

Agartala, 22nd July 2025:  The Jan Adhikar Sangram Parishad of Tripura organized a peaceful protest at the Churaibari border today denouncing the recent eviction drive initiated by the Assam government in border-adjacent areas. The demonstration aimed to draw attention to the plight of displaced families and demand financial assistance and proper rehabilitation measures for those affected.

Senior members and activists of the organization, including leader Anjan Shukla Baidya took part in the dharna. Addressing the gathering, Baidya stated that many of the evicted residents had been living in the area for decades and belonged to economically disadvantaged sections. He criticized the lack of rehabilitation efforts prior to the evictions, calling it a “serious violation of human rights.”

A memorandum articulating their concerns and demands was reportedly submitted online to the Governor of Assam. Local police from Churaibari station were deployed in strength to maintain law and order, ensuring the demonstration concluded without incident.

Churaibari, located on the sensitive Tripura-Assam border, often witnesses friction due to land disputes and administrative actions. In a public statement, Jan Adhikar Sangram Parishad warned that they may escalate their movement if the Assam government fails to address the demands.
